Transaction 6259c85ab0615c87af04c1632fe1a84892838306cc9abbe716557482509ad9fa
1 Input
1 Output
-
6259c85ab0615c87af04c1632fe1a84892838306cc9abbe716557482509ad9fa:0
- value
- 342829
- script pubkey
- OP_0 OP_PUSHBYTES_20 64709f0b01d2204f1f6aa3630f80a1d517b7bd23
- address
- bc1qv3cf7zcp6gsy78m25d3slq9p65tm00frey2w76